Dress Codes and Social Norms
Social norms establish a wide range of behaviors, including the way we present ourselves. Dress codes, typically implemented in official settings, represent these societal expectations. Complying with dress codes can indicate respect for the situation and those around. Violation of dress codes can sometimes be seen as a disrespectful act, potentially leading to negative consequences.
However, the definitions of dress codes can be fluid, and what is considered acceptable in one culture may not be in another. Furthermore, evolving social norms are steadily challenging traditional dress codes, leading to a growing debate about the role of attire in present-day culture.
